The compressive strength of concrete refers to how many pounds per square inch (psi) it can handle when force is applied. ... These tests are conducted on cylindrical concrete specimens (per ASTM C39) using a machine that compresses the cylinders until they crack or break completely (see Concrete Testing Procedures). …

The aim of determining the uniaxial compressive strength of concrete is to evaluate its resistance and verify if it aligns with the project's design strength. This test is crucial for quality control, providing insight into the concrete's actual strength compared to the intended design strength [9].

The compressive strength of the concrete cylinder is one of the most common performance measures performed by the engineers in the structural design. Here, the compressive strength of concrete cylinders is determined by applying continuous load over the cylinder until failure occurs. ... The test is conducted on a compression-testing …





In the building and construction sectors, Compression Testing Machines are used to assess the quality of concrete. To find the compressive strength of concrete, cubes or cylinders are put through a series of compression tests on the CTM machine. Compressive Strength Test of Concrete. The compressive strength test of concrete is an essential procedure that helps engineers and construction professionals evaluate the strength and durability of concrete structures. The test is commonly done on concrete cubes, using a compressive testing machine to determine the maximum compression …
